WHO warns of spike in COVID-19 cases in Ramadan


Published 03 Apr,2021 via Muscat Daily - The World Health Organization has expressed concern about the recent spike in COVID-19 cases in the Eastern Mediterranean Region. It has further warned that with Ramadan around the corner, ‘there is a danger’ of ‘even more increases in cases and deaths’ in the region.
